Just how a lawyer Detects Capabilities Lender Dilemmas

a ready prestigious domain attorney will frequently investigate any residential loans on the property prior to the government really files condemnation. The lawyers may inquire the government’s label google and could boost it with regards to their very own concept look, being diagnose banking institutions that could be due cash from the condemnation.

If federal government has filed condemnation, any bankers involved must (however they are not at all times) discovered inside the preliminary Complaint. If any banking companies are actually placed in the issue, the attorneys probably will check with authorization from customers to make contact with the lender, and then try to have the financial to accept a possibility which favor the property or house holder.

So if a financial institution is definitely present, you will likely discover youself to be in one of the four issues the following.

Choice 1: Benefit

In the event that numbers the government provides you with is definitely greater than the sum you nevertheless have on your property, most commonly it is simple enough to solve your budget issue.

The attorneys would just demand an up-to-date compensation levels from the financial institution, and have the financial institution paid completely through the first deposit (initial test). Any cash leftover would subsequently staying yours and so the financial would no further don’t mind spending time for the following claim, you will be absolve to realize additional only payment (next confirm) without the financial institution getting into the way in which.

Solution 2: Total Waiver

In some situations, the government’s present is definitely lower plenty of that there’s no inducement for a bank to pursue they. Like for example, let’s claim government entities is only getting modest portion of your property and simply spending your multiple thousand because of it. In these instances, it can be achievable to find the bank to accept waive all involvement in the money and lawsuit.

If a financial institution agrees to the waiver, they’re going to have no-claim on the first first deposit (1st check), as well as to any future income gathered from the lawsuit (next test). This doesn’t indicate your budget is definitely forgiving your loan, it really suggests you could tend to pay off character, or all, or not one on the debt aided by the income you receive through the authorities.

Option 3: Partial Waiver

In the event the money volume is definitely adequate that the financial institution should not agree to waive their attention inside, but not sufficient enough to completely repay the loan, the attorney could most likely create a partial waiver.

To do this, he or she will look at the deed of put your trust in for your specific assets to figure out just what portion of the first deposit the financial institution is really owed. Some deeds of count on have got clauses that figure out how much your budget will receive if discover “damages” towards residential property. For instance, it state that the lender happens to be eligible for 80percent of settlement.

Occasionally your very own attorneys could possibly get the lender to accept a portion (80% in sample above) of what the federal stores (1st consult) and waive their interest in just about any future compensation (next examine).

In other situation, the lender might observe that the government has not remunerated you sufficient for the “damages” towards your house, but rather of using to employ their particular appraisers and lawyers, your very own lawyer just might utilize the lender to find those to acknowledge the number of the deposit (earliest test), while waiving their attention in virtually any upcoming money from the claim (2nd consult).

Option 4: Limited Payoff and Re-finance

Occasionally the lawyers can’t eliminate the financial by paying off the money or by having the lender accept waive all or a component of their attention through the money from the causing lawsuit (second test).

In such cases, great track is usually to host the entire quantity the first deposit (basic examine) mailed to the lender, paying off your loan. Typically, you’ll then maintain placement to refinance to either allow your finance to be reduced more rapidly as well as to reduce your monthly installments.
